ELECTRICAL INFORMATION Guidelines for using extension cords When using an extension cord, be sure to use one heavy enough to carry the current your product will draw. An undersized cord will cause a drop in line voltage resulting in loss of power and overheating. Cutting large sheets Large sheet or boards require support to prevent bends or sags. If you attempt to cut without levelling and properly supporting the work piece, the blade will tend to bind, causing kickback. Support the panel or board close to the cut. MAINTENANCE Warning: Do not at any time let brake fluids, gasoline, petroleum-based products, penetrating oils, etc., come in contact with plastic parts. Chemicals can damage, weaken or destroy plastic which may result in serious personal injury. Regular cleaning is required for the safe operation of the tool, as an excessive buildup of dust will prevent the tool from operating correctly.
